Invitation to join the BEA/BPA Task Force on Doctoral Competencies in Health Service Psychology

 

The Board of Professional Affairs cordially invites you to a listening session to provide feedback to the BEA/ BPA Task Force on Doctoral Competencies in Health Service Psychology (HSP). This task force was appointed jointly by the Board of Professional Affairs (BPA) and the Board of Educational Affairs (BEA) to update the existing competencies for those graduating with a doctoral degree in HSP. The task force has identified three questions for which it seeks broad feedback so as to guide its work. During this listening session, attendees will be asked to provide feedback to the following questions posed by the task force:

 

  • We will be grounding the competencies in Equity, Diversity, & Inclusion (EDI) principles. How would you suggest we might best do that?

 

  • What makes the doctoral degree in HSP distinctive from master's degree in HSP and other mental health service fields?

 

  • Thinking about the future of HSP, what should we be preparing psychologists to be able to do? 

 

These important questions reflect conversations happening within the discipline both in terms of how psychology can advance a more equitable healthcare framework, one that integrates population health strategies, social determinants of health and health equity, best practices, and quality care, and how psychologists can be best prepared to meet behavioral health needs today and in the future.
